The Role of Regulations in Online Casinos

Regulations serve as a double-edged sword for online casinos. On one hand, they create a safe and fair gambling environment that builds trust with players; on the other, they impose restrictions that can curtail profitability. The core objectives of these regulations typically include:

  • Ensuring player protection
  • Promoting responsible gambling
  • Preventing underage gambling
  • Combating money laundering and other illegal activities

In jurisdictions with clear, well-enforced regulations, online casinos often enjoy a higher level of trust from players, which can lead to increased revenue. Conversely, overly stringent regulations can discourage business investment or lead to higher operational costs, potentially affecting profits negatively.

How Compliance Costs Affect Profit Margins

Compliance with regulations often comes with significant expenses. These costs may include licensing fees, taxation, technology investments for secure transactions, and human resources for compliance management. Specifically, operators should consider the following compliance cost factors:

  • Licensing fees: These can be substantial, often requiring considerable upfront investment.
  • Operational costs: Staff salaries for compliance teams can add to overhead costs.
  • Technical expenditures: Investments in secure platforms and auditing processes are essential.
  • Tax liabilities: Many jurisdictions impose taxing rates that impact gross revenue, affecting profit margins.

These costs, if unaccounted for, can eat into the profit margins of even the most successful online casinos. As a result, balancing compliance and profitability becomes a critical task for operators. They must navigate these costs while still providing attractive offerings to consumers.

Future Trends in Regulation and Their Implications

As the online casino landscape evolves, trends in regulations are likely to continue changing, influenced by advancements in technology and social attitudes towards gambling. For example, many jurisdictions are beginning to explore the integration of blockchain technology to promote transparency and fairness, which could reshape the way casinos operate. Key future trends include:

  • Increased focus on data protection and privacy regulations.
  • Incorporation of artificial intelligence for responsible gambling tools.
  • Greater international collaboration among regulatory bodies.
  • Development of regulations tailored to emerging technologies and gaming formats.

These trends indicate that while regulations may pose challenges, they can also present opportunities for innovation and improved customer relationships. Operators who can adapt to these changes are likely to maintain or even improve profitability.
